This rocket needs a program that allows it to automatically enter orbit of Vulco, Sergeea, Droo, Cylero, or any of their moons. It needs to work from the DSC launchpad, and the player needs to be able to enter the destination planet or moon at launch, as well as the perigee and apogee of the desired orbit, and the maximum amount of time that the orbit can take. The perigee and apogee can be off by up to 100km. Please don't do any rocket surgery.
